Oklahoma Deer Hunters Break Records 07/20/08
Being in the right place at the right time has a whole new meaning for two Oklahoma deer hunters who both harvested record-breaking whitetail bucks in 2007. Both state record bucks were officially scored July 9 by Oklahoma Department of Wildlife Conservation officials with Boone and Crockett scoring certification. [Comments?]

Bowhunting Success in Wisconsin
My buck was shot in Sauk county Wisconsin; it was during the 2006 bowhunting season. It was early October and the rut had not started yet. He presented me with about a 20 yard shot quartering away in a cut hay field. He weighed 250 lbs and has 9 points scoring 130 B/C.
